From 2d9aa39f1cbd73e85dae72837daab61c309aff4a Mon Sep 17 00:00:00 2001 From: Eric Cadow Date: Wed, 13 May 2015 16:57:29 -0600 Subject: [PATCH] fix($templateRequest): Set `Accept` header on template requests Set the `Accept` header on HTTP requests for templates to `text/html, text/ng-template`. Previously the default request headers sent by `$http` were used. Closes #6860 --- src/ng/templateRequest.js |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/src/ng/templateRequest.js b/src/ng/templateRequest.js index 5760dde0b973..4920ced5dbaf 100644 --- a/src/ng/templateRequest.js +++ b/src/ng/templateRequest.js @@ -36,7 +36,8 @@ function $TemplateRequestProvider() { var httpOptions = { cache: $templateCache, - transformResponse: transformResponse + transformResponse: transformResponse, + headers: { 'Accept': 'text/html, text/ng-template' } }; return $http.get(tpl, httpOptions)